Historical Performance Review
NeuroOne Medical reported a revenue of $1.39 million in Q2 2025, marking a period of financial challenges with a net income of -$2.27 million and an EPS of -$0.07. Despite these losses, the company achieved a gross profit of $771.06 thousand, showcasing resilience in its operational activities and maintaining a foundation for future growth amidst the competitive medical technology sector.

Additional News
NeuroOne continues to advance its high-definition, minimally invasive electrode technology, focusing on diagnostic and therapeutic applications for neurological conditions. The company's OneRF Ablation System, the only FDA-approved sEEG-RF system, has been successfully utilized for bedside monitoring and ablation procedures, reducing costs and operating room time. NeuroOne's CEO, Dave Rosa, highlighted the significance of these clinical milestones, emphasizing the company's commitment to expanding safe therapies for neurological patients. The strategic partnership with a global medical technology firm, granting exclusive distribution rights, reflects NeuroOne's proactive approach to market expansion and aligning with industry leaders to address unmet clinical needs.
